# HadoopLinux下的安装与使用 > 作者:[你的名字] ![journey](journey) Hadoop是一个开源的分布式计算框架,用于处理大规模数据集的分布式存储和处理。由于其高效可靠的特性,Hadoop被广泛应用于大数据领域。然而,Hadoop只能安装在Linux操作系统上。本文将介绍如何在Linux安装和配置Hadoop,并给出一些简单的示例代码。 ## Linux
原创 2023-08-17 08:20:41
119阅读
安装和配置Hadoop 集群1 网络拓扑通常来说,一个Hadoop 的集群体系结构由两层网络拓扑组成,如图2-1 所示。结合实际的应用来看,每个机架中会有30 ~ 40 台机器,这些机器共享一个1GB 带宽的网络交换机。在所有的机架之上还有一个核心交换机或路由器,通常来说其网络交换能力为1GB 或更高。可以很明显地看出,同一个机架中机器节点之间的带宽资源肯定要比不同机架中机器节点间丰富。这也是Ha
上一节知识点说了,一般使用Docker都是在Linux上,Windows有VMware就够了,所以本篇知识点同理带大家在CentOS Linux安装Docker,但是要知道一个事情,CentOS 6系列的系统由于官方yum的关闭而处于不推荐使用的系统,所以本系列Docker博文均操作于CentOS 7 上,同时Docker分企业版和社区版,一般情况下都是社区版,俗称“Docker CE”,包括企
NO.1 想要学好大数据需掌握哪些技术?答:1,Java编程技术Java编程技术是大数据学习的基础,Java是一种强类型语言,拥有极高的跨平台能力,可以编写桌面应用程序、Web应用程序、分布式系统和嵌入式系统应用程序等,是大数据工程师最喜欢的编程工具,因此,想学好大数据,掌握Java基础是必不可少的!2.Linux命令对于大数据开发通常是在Linux环境下进行的,相比Linux操作系统,Windo
# Docker只能装在Linux吗? ## 介绍 在介绍Docker只能装在Linux之前,我们先来了解一下什么是Docker。Docker是一种开源的容器化平台,它可以让开发者将应用程序和所有依赖项打包到一个可移植的容器中,并在任何地方运行。Docker的优点包括快速部署、轻量级、灵活性等。 Docker在不同的操作系统上有不同的实现方式,其中最常用的就是在Linux安装Docker。虽
原创 2023-11-18 06:08:52
612阅读
Hive的运行需要在Hadoop环境下Hive使用Hadoop,所以:您必须在您的路径中安装Hadoopexport HADOOP_HOME=<hadoop-install-dir>此外,在创建hive表时,必须使用以下命令HDFS创建/tmp和/user/hive/warehouse(又名hive.metastore.warehouse.dir),并设置它们权限chmod g+w&n
转载 2023-07-12 17:58:48
49阅读
目录Hadoop安装与运行1. 笔者所用环境2. 从安装到运行2.1 设置SSH登录权限2.2 安装JAVA环境2.3 安装hadoop2.4 进行伪分布式配置2.5 启动伪分布式hadoop2.6 处理WARN2.7 运行Hadoop伪分布式实例Hadoop安装与运行  Hadoop安装大致分为5步:创建hadoop用户(Mac系统就用自己的用户吧,这一步就省略了,免得引起不必要
文章目录什么是HBase一、事前准备1、虚拟机上安装Hadoop2、虚拟机上安装有Zookeeper3、HBase安装包二、安装HBase三、HBase的三种运行模式1、本地模式2、伪分布模式3、全分布式 什么是HBaseHbase的名字的来源是Hadoop database,即hadoop数据库; 适合于存储大表数据(表的规模可以达到数十亿行以及数百万列),并且对大表数据的读、写访问可以达到
转载 2023-10-12 22:24:46
63阅读
说明:该文章以4台centos系统为案例配置hadoop基础集群,节点名字分别为hadoop02,hadoop03,hadoop04,hadoop051.基础集群环境准备1.1修改主机名在root用户下:vi /etc/sysconfig/network或者如何配置了hadoop账户的sudo权限,则在hadoop登陆情况下使用命令 sudo vi/etc/sysconfig/network修改
# Java只能安装在C盘吗? Java是当今广泛使用的编程语言之一,它的安装位置通常引发了一些疑问,特别是关于是否只能安装在C盘的问题。实际上,Java并不限制安装目录,用户可以根据个人需求将其安装在任何其他盘符中。 ## Java安装路径的灵活性 Java的安装路径是由用户在安装过程中自行选择的。在Windows操作系统中,Java通常会默认为C:\Program Files\Java,
原创 2024-08-29 07:49:20
967阅读
## 如何在非C盘安装Yarn ### 1. 简介 在开始之前,我们需要了解一些基本概念和步骤。Yarn是一个用于管理 JavaScript 代码包的包管理器,类似于 npm。它允许你下载、更新和管理项目中的依赖关系。默认情况下,Yarn将安装在系统的C盘上,但我们也可以将其安装在其他分区。 ### 2. 安装 Node.js 在使用 Yarn 之前,我们需要先安装 Node.js。Nod
原创 2023-11-25 11:47:10
213阅读
据外媒,SpaceX在其载人飞船发射的实验中又向前迈进了一大步。这家私人航天公司周日(1月19日)在发射中故意摧毁了其中一枚火箭,这是对其新的载人龙飞船的发射逃生系统进行的关键测试的一部分。 “总体而言,这到目前为止是一项完美的任务,” SpaceX CEO埃隆·马斯克(Elon Musk)在测试后的新闻发布会上说。“我心潮澎湃,这太棒了。”这项并未搭乘乘客的被称为飞行中中
转载 9月前
42阅读
前言今天这篇文章是比较偏“教程”一点的文章。但也由浅入深,认真地分析了源码,并且介绍了一些在使用Spring Cache中常见的问题和解决方案,肯定是比简单的入门文档更有深度一些的,相信大家看了之后会有一定的收获。容器化时代来了虚拟化技术已经走过了三个时代,没有容器化技术的演进就不会有 Docker 技术的诞生。虚拟化技术演进(1)物理机时代:多个应用程序可能会跑在一台机器上。(2)虚拟机时代:一
      由于在windows上安装docker,需要开启Hyper-V ,之后虚拟机就不能再使用了,这里将docker安装在虚拟机里的Ubuntu系统上。使用secureCRT远程连接Ubuntu,下面介绍下docker:1.1docker介绍 官网所述:Docker 是一个开源的应用容器引擎,基于 Go 语言 并遵从 Apache2
Opengauss是一种新型的开源数据库管理系统,它提供了高性能、高可靠性、高可扩展性的数据存储和处理能力。然而,对于刚入行的小白来说,可能不清楚Opengauss只能Linux系统中安装。在本文中,我将向你介绍如何实现Opengauss的安装,并详细介绍每个步骤需要执行的操作和相应的代码。 首先,让我们来看一下整个安装Opengauss的流程。我们可以使用以下表格来展示每个步骤和相关的代码:
原创 2024-01-13 00:47:35
159阅读
Linux中查看Hadoop安装位置的方法有很多种,以下是一种常用的方法: 1. 首先,我们可以使用`which`命令来查找Hadoop安装路径。`which`命令会在系统的`$PATH`变量中查找指定命令的路径。我们可以运行以下命令来查看Hadoop安装路径: ```bash $ which hadoop ``` 如果Hadoop已经正确安装并在`$PATH`中,该命令将显示Hado
原创 2023-09-15 07:35:17
1742阅读
Linux系统中,如何实现bugfree的安装呢?随着Linux操作系统的普及和应用范围的不断扩大,越来越多的软件在Linux平台上被广泛应用。而bugfree是一款非常实用和强大的软件,它为Linux系统用户提供了强大的功能和工具,使他们能够更加高效地管理和监控系统。因此,如何在Linux系统中实现bugfree的安装成为了很多用户关注的问题。在本文中,我们将介绍如何在Linux系统中实现bu
原创 2024-04-11 10:35:48
113阅读
Loadrunner是一款非常知名的性能测试工具,广泛应用于软件开发和测试领域。它可以帮助开发人员在开发过程中发现和解决性能问题,提高软件的质量和稳定性。在Linux系统上安装Loadrunner,也是许多开发人员关注的话题之一。 首先,为什么选择在Linux系统上安装Loadrunner呢?Linux系统具有稳定性高、性能好等优点,许多开发人员喜欢在Linux系统上进行开发和测试工作。因此,在
原创 2024-05-07 11:05:38
81阅读
Jenkins是一个用于自动化构建、测试和部署软件的开源工具。它可以帮助开发团队更高效地管理项目,并提高软件交付的质量和速度。在Linux系统上安装Jenkins是一个常见的操作,下面将介绍如何在Linux系统上安装Jenkins以及一些常见的配置操作。 首先,我们需要确保Linux系统上已经安装了Java环境,因为Jenkins是基于Java开发的。我们可以通过以下命令来检查Java环境是否已
原创 2024-04-16 11:19:44
51阅读
本教程是在 Centos6 下使用yum来安装 CDH5 版本的 hadoop 的教程。 如果没有添加yum源的请参考上一个教程:Hadoop架构图 NameNode、DataNode和ClientNameNode可以看作是分布式文件系统中的管理者,主要负责管理文件系统的命名空间、集群配置信息和存储块的复制等。NameNode会将文件系统的Meta-data存储在内存中,这些信息主要包括了文
  • 1
  • 2
  • 3
  • 4
  • 5